Fund profile
As filed in the prospectus · 2025 Q3
The funds investment objective is to provide you with long-term growth of capital while providing current income.
The fund invests at least 90% of its assets in stocks of companies outside the United States, including emerging markets, that the adviser believes offer growth potential or dividend income, with holdings across at least three countries. The adviser employs multiple portfolio managers, each overseeing segments of the portfolio, and focuses on attractively valued dividend-paying stocks believed to be more resilient during market declines. Because performance depends on the adviser's judgments about which companies represent good long-term opportunities, results will diverge from any benchmark.
